View of Model Fish Robots



Let's discuss the structure of the fish robots. What is the better power sourse? What type is better body shape?
My information of several previous prototype fish robots are shown here.


"Dry Land" Fish Robot, Prototype PPF-01

What type mechanism is suitable to simulate the real fish? The PPF-01 is designed and manufactured in order to discuss the link mechanism mainly.

Previous Prototype Fish Robot, PPF-02

The PPF-02 uses pulse motors for the power source.

Previous Prototype Fish Robot, PPF-03

I hope to work the fish robot in the water. The PPF-03 can swim in the water, because parts of power motor and source are been waterproof. It uses a rotated type D/C motor as the power source.

Previous Prototype Fish Robot, PPF-04

The PPF-04 is a small fish robot with 190 mm length. It can simulate complex motions with two servo motors of a radio control (R/C) model.

Previous Prototype Fish Robot, PPF-05

The PPF-05 uses a D/C motor as the power source. This fish robot is small and slim size.

Model Fish Robot, PPF-06i

The model fish robot named PPF-06i is introduced here. The PPF-06i has a micro computer.

Model Fish Robot, PPF-07i

The small fish robot named PPF-07i is introduced here. It has a simple structure and a micro computer.

Model Fish Robot, PPF-08i

The model fish robot PPF-08i aims to get high turning performance.

Model Fish Robot, PPF-09
The model fish robot, PPF-09 aims to get a good performance of the 3-D motion including a turning and up^down motions.

Model Fish Robot, PPF-10 with 3-D Video Camera
The PPF-10 is an image model that has two CCD cameras for a 3-D video. It can not move and swim at all.
